sudoifconfigeth0
① linux鉶氭嫙緗戝崱鎬庝箞閰嶇疆linux鉶氭嫙緗戝崱
鉶氭嫙緗戝崱鎸囩殑鏄浠涔堬紵
鐢ㄨ蔣浠跺疄鐜拌櫄鎷熺殑緗戝崱錛屼篃灝辨槸璇村儚鎻掍笂涓鍧楃湡緗戝崱涓鏍峰畨瑁咃細娣誨姞鏂扮‖浠訛紝閫夌綉緇滈傞厤鍣錛屽啀閫塎icrosoft閲岀殑MicrosoftLoopbackAdapter錛屼笅涓姝ュ嵆鍙銆備嬌鐢錛氬拰鏅閫氱綉鍗$殑浣跨敤涓鏍楓備綔鐢錛氭湁涓浜涜蔣浠墮渶瑕佷嬌鐢ㄨ櫄鎷熺綉鍗$殑錛屼互鍙婂湪鏈嶅姟鍣ㄤ笂鍙浠ュ炲姞澶氫竴浜沇EB鐨処P鍦板潃銆
linux鎬庝箞鍒涘緩涓涓鉶氭嫙緗戝崱錛
Linux娣誨姞鉶氭嫙緗戝崱鐨勫氱嶆柟娉曟湁鏃跺,涓鍙版湇鍔″櫒闇瑕佽劇疆澶氫釜ip,浣嗗張涓嶆兂娣誨姞澶氬潡緗戝崱,閭e氨闇瑕佽劇疆鉶氭嫙緗戝崱.榪欓噷浠嬬粛鍑犵嶆柟寮忓湪Linux鏈嶅姟鍣ㄤ笂娣誨姞鉶氭嫙緗戝崱.鎴戜滑鍚慹th0涓娣誨姞涓鍧楄櫄鎷熺綉鍗:絎涓縐嶆柟娉:蹇閫掑壋寤哄垹闄よ櫄鎷熺綉鍗sudoifconfigeth0:0192.168.10.10up浠ヤ笂鐨勫懡浠ゅ氨鍙浠ュ湪eth0緗戝崱涓婂壋寤轟竴涓鍙玡th0:0鐨勮櫄鎷熺綉鍗,浠栫殑鍦板潃鏄:192.168.1.63濡傛灉涓嶆兂瑕佽繖涓鉶氭嫙緗戝崱浜,鍙浠ヤ嬌鐢ㄥ備笅鍛戒護鍒犻櫎:sudoifconfigeth0:0down閲嶅惎鏈嶅姟鍣ㄦ垨鑰呯綉緇滃悗,鉶氭嫙緗戝崱灝辨病鏈変簡.hzhsan:浣嗘槸鍙戠幇娣誨姞鐨勮櫄鎷熺綉鍗″拰鍘熺綉鍗$墿鐞嗗湴鍧鏄涓鏍風殑銆
絎浜岀嶆柟娉:淇鏀圭綉鍗¢厤緗鏂囦歡鍦╱buntu涓,緗戝崱鐨勯厤緗鏂囦歡鏄/etc/network/interfaces,鎵浠ユ垜浠淇鏀瑰畠:sudovim/etc/network/interfaces鍦ㄨ繖涓鏂囦歡涓澧炲姞濡備笅鍐呭瑰苟淇濆瓨:autoeth0:0ifaceeth0:0inetstaticaddress192.168.10.10netmask255.255.255.0#network192.168.10.1#broadcast192.168.1.255淇濆瓨鍚,鎴戜滑闇瑕侀噸鍚緗戝崱(閲嶆柊鍔犺澆閰嶇疆鏂囦歡)鎵嶄細鐢熸晥,浣跨敤濡備笅鍛戒護閲嶅惎:sudo/etc/init.d/networkingrestart浠栫殑浼樼偣鏄閲嶅惎鏈嶅姟鍣ㄦ垨鑰呯綉鍗¢厤緗涓嶄細涓㈠け銆-------------------------------------------鍦╨inux涓鉶氭嫙緗戝崱鐨勬柟娉曠涓夌嶆柟娉曪細鍒涘緩tap鍓嶄袱縐嶆柟娉曢兘鏈変竴涓鐗圭偣錛屽壋寤虹殑緗戝崱鍙鏈変笉鍚岀殑ip鍦板潃錛屼絾鏄疢ac鍦板潃鐩稿悓銆傛棤娉曠敤鏉ュ壋寤鴻櫄鎷熸満銆傛坊鍔犺櫄鎷熺綉鍗taptunctl-b闄勪笂鐩稿叧鍛戒護錛氭樉紺虹綉妗ヤ俊鎮痓rctlshow娣誨姞緗戞ˉbrctladdbrvirbr0嬋媧葷綉妗iplinksetvirbr0up娣誨姞鉶氭嫙緗戝崱taptunctl-btap0------->鎵ц屼笂闈浣垮懡灝變細鐢熸垚涓涓猼ap,鍚庣紑浠0錛1錛2渚濇¢掑炴縺媧誨壋寤虹殑tapiplinksettap0up灝唗ap0鉶氭嫙緗戝崱娣誨姞鍒版寚瀹氱綉妗ヤ笂銆俠rctladdifbr0tap0緇欑綉妗ラ厤鍒秈p鍦板潃ifconfigvirbr1169.254.251.4up灝唙irbr1緗戞ˉ涓婄粦瀹氱殑緗戝崱eth5瑙i櫎brctldelifvirb1eth5緇檝irbr1緗戞ˉ娣誨姞緗戝崱eth6brctladdifvirbr1eth6Linux鎬庝箞淇鏀硅櫄鎷熺綉鍗★紵
1銆佷嬌鐢╥fconfig鏌ョ湅緗戝崱IP
2銆乮fup/ifdownens33鏉ュ惎鐢ㄥ拰紱佺敤緗戝崱
3銆乮fdownens33ifupens33閲嶅惎緗戝崱
4銆佽劇疆涓鍧楄櫄鎷熺綉鍗
錛1錛夊皢鐗╃悊緗戝崱鎷瘋礉涓浠藉苟閲嶅懡鍚
錛2錛変慨鏀硅櫄鎷熺綉鍗$殑IP鍦板潃鍙婄綉鍗″悕
錛3錛夋煡鐪嬮厤緗
5銆佹煡鐪嬬綉鍗℃槸鍚﹁繛鎺
錛1錛塵ii-toolens33鎴栬卐thtoolens33
6銆佹洿鏀逛富鏈哄悕閰嶇疆
鍙浠ュ湪/etc/hostname涓淇鏀癸紝浣嗘槸閲嶅惎鍚庢墠鐢熸晥
hostnamectlset-hostname=xxx涓嶇敤閲嶅惎涔熷彲浠ョ敓鏁
7銆丏NS閰嶇疆鏂囦歡/etc/resolv.conf
鉶氭嫙緗戝崱寮傚父鎬庝箞澶勭悊錛
瑙e喅鏂規硶
鏌ョ湅鉶氭嫙緗戝崱鏄鍚﹀畨瑁呭湪緋葷粺涓婂苟澶勪簬鍚鍔ㄧ姸鎬侊細
鎺у埗闈㈡澘-璁懼囩$悊鍣-緗戠粶閫傞厤鍣ㄤ腑媯鏌ヨ櫄鎷熺綉鍗℃槸鍚﹀畨瑁呮垚鍔燂紱
鍦ㄧ綉緇滆繛鎺ヤ腑媯鏌ヨ櫄鎷熺綉鍗℃槸鍚﹁紱佺敤
緗戠粶榪炴帴
鍗歌澆EasyConnect鎴愬姛鍚庯紝鎵撳紑鏈嶅姟錛屽皢璇ユ湇鍔$殑鑷鍔ㄦ墽琛屾敼涓烘墜鍔錛岄噸鍚璁$畻鏈恆
鏈嶅姟
鍒犻櫎C:ProgramFiles(x86)Sangfor鏂囦歡澶癸紱鍦–鐩樻悳緔Sangfor鍏抽敭瀛楋紝鎶婃悳緔㈠埌鐨勬枃浠朵互鍙婃枃浠跺す鍏ㄩ儴鍒犻櫎錛堣嫢鎻愮ず鏃犳潈闄愶細鍙沖嚮鏂囦歡->綆$悊鍛樺彇寰楁墍鏈夋潈錛
鍒╃敤鐢佃剳綆″舵垨鍏朵粬杞浠剁″訛紝娓呯悊娉ㄥ唽琛
浠ョ$悊鍛樿韓浠藉畨瑁匛asyConnect錛屽畨瑁呮垚鍔熴
杈撳叆鍦板潃錛岀櫥褰曪紝榪炴帴鎴愬姛
linux鉶氭嫙緗戝崱tap鎬庝箞鐢錛
Linux娣誨姞鉶氭嫙緗戝崱鐨勫氱嶆柟娉曟湁鏃跺,涓鍙版湇鍔″櫒闇瑕佽劇疆澶氫釜ip,浣嗗張涓嶆兂娣誨姞澶氬潡緗戝崱,閭e氨闇瑕佽劇疆鉶氭嫙緗戝崱.榪欓噷浠嬬粛鍑犵嶆柟寮忓湪Linux鏈嶅姟鍣ㄤ笂娣誨姞鉶氭嫙緗戝崱.鎴戜滑鍚慹th0涓娣誨姞涓鍧楄櫄鎷熺綉鍗:絎涓縐嶆柟娉:蹇閫掑壋寤哄垹闄よ櫄鎷熺綉鍗sudoifconfigeth0:0192.168.10.10up浠ヤ笂鐨勫懡浠ゅ氨鍙浠ュ湪eth0緗戝崱涓婂壋寤轟竴涓鍙玡th0:0鐨勮櫄鎷熺綉鍗,浠栫殑鍦板潃鏄:192.168.1.63濡傛灉涓嶆兂瑕佽繖涓鉶氭嫙緗戝崱浜,鍙浠ヤ嬌鐢ㄥ備笅鍛戒護鍒犻櫎:sudoifconfigeth0:0down閲嶅惎鏈嶅姟鍣ㄦ垨鑰呯綉緇滃悗,鉶氭嫙緗戝崱灝辨病鏈変簡.hzhsan:浣嗘槸鍙戠幇娣誨姞鐨勮櫄鎷熺綉鍗″拰鍘熺綉鍗$墿鐞嗗湴鍧鏄涓鏍風殑銆
絎浜岀嶆柟娉:淇鏀圭綉鍗¢厤緗鏂囦歡鍦╱buntu涓,緗戝崱鐨勯厤緗鏂囦歡鏄/etc/network/interfaces,鎵浠ユ垜浠淇鏀瑰畠:sudovim/etc/network/interfaces鍦ㄨ繖涓鏂囦歡涓澧炲姞濡備笅鍐呭瑰苟淇濆瓨:autoeth0:0ifaceeth0:0inetstaticaddress192.168.10.10netmask255.255.255.0#network192.168.10.1#broadcast192.168.1.255淇濆瓨鍚,鎴戜滑闇瑕侀噸鍚緗戝崱(閲嶆柊鍔犺澆閰嶇疆鏂囦歡)鎵嶄細鐢熸晥,浣跨敤濡備笅鍛戒護閲嶅惎:sudo/etc/init.d/networkingrestart浠栫殑浼樼偣鏄閲嶅惎鏈嶅姟鍣ㄦ垨鑰呯綉鍗¢厤緗涓嶄細涓㈠け銆-------------------------------------------鍦╨inux涓鉶氭嫙緗戝崱鐨勬柟娉曠涓夌嶆柟娉曪細鍒涘緩tap鍓嶄袱縐嶆柟娉曢兘鏈変竴涓鐗圭偣錛屽壋寤虹殑緗戝崱鍙鏈変笉鍚岀殑ip鍦板潃錛屼絾鏄疢ac鍦板潃鐩稿悓銆傛棤娉曠敤鏉ュ壋寤鴻櫄鎷熸満銆傛坊鍔犺櫄鎷熺綉鍗taptunctl-b闄勪笂鐩稿叧鍛戒護錛氭樉紺虹綉妗ヤ俊鎮痓rctlshow娣誨姞緗戞ˉbrctladdbrvirbr0嬋媧葷綉妗iplinksetvirbr0up娣誨姞鉶氭嫙緗戝崱taptunctl-btap0------->鎵ц屼笂闈浣垮懡灝變細鐢熸垚涓涓猼ap,鍚庣紑浠0錛1錛2渚濇¢掑炴縺媧誨壋寤虹殑tapiplinksettap0up灝唗ap0鉶氭嫙緗戝崱娣誨姞鍒版寚瀹氱綉妗ヤ笂銆俠rctladdifbr0tap0緇欑綉妗ラ厤鍒秈p鍦板潃ifconfigvirbr1169.254.251.4up灝唙irbr1緗戞ˉ涓婄粦瀹氱殑緗戝崱eth5瑙i櫎brctldelifvirb1eth5緇檝irbr1緗戞ˉ娣誨姞緗戝崱eth6brctladdifvirbr1eth6
② linux系統不能上網,提示無法激活eth0
setup選NETWORK
或有的版本用netconfig 設置
或vi /etc/sysconfig/network-script/ifcfg-eth0
改為
DEVICE=eth0
ONBOOT=YES
BOOTPROTO=dhcp
重啟網路服務service network restart
一般可使用如果已設為DHCP可使用dhclient eth0
③ 虛擬機Linux下ifconfig eth0 up為什麼改不了ip,
/etc/sysconfig/network-scripts/ifcfg-eth0關鍵配置:
BOOTPROTO=none 或者static的時候,你要加入:
IPADDR=ip
GATEWAY=網關
PREFIX=掩碼
BOOTPROTO=dhcp的時候,以上3個不用加。
編輯好 /etc/sysconfig/network-scripts/ifcfg-eth0 過後
要用命令 ifup eth0 來啟用網卡或者 service network restart 重啟網路
④ linux中利用ifconfig eth0 up時顯示許可權不夠怎麼辦
linux中利用ifconfig eth0 up時顯示許可權不夠時可以採用下面方法解決:
執行命令前切換到root用戶後執行該命令,切換到root的方法:
不管是用圖形模式登錄Ubuntu,還是命令行模式登錄,我們會發現預設的用戶是user
但是當我們需要執行一些具有root許可權的操作(如修還系統文件)時,經常需要用sudo授權
此時我們可以切換到root用戶,只需要簡單的執行sudo su 即可
注意: 出於安全考慮,默認時Ubuntu的root用戶時沒有固定密碼的,它的密碼是隨機產生並且動態改變
的,貌似是每5分鍾改變一次,所以用su(switch user)是不可以的,因為我們不知道root的密碼
默認root用戶是無固定密碼的,並且是被鎖定的,如果想給root設置一個密碼
只需執行命令:sudo passwd root 然後根據提示一步一步來
這樣皆可以向(1)裡面提到的那樣 su root ,輸入root密碼切換到root用戶
注意:給root設定密碼後,仍可以 sudo su 切換到root用戶
附:在圖形模式下 系統->系統管理->用戶和組 也可以給root設置密碼
⑤ Ubuntu下配置IP地址的方法
一、使用命令設置ubuntu的ip地址
1.修改配置文件blacklist.conf禁用IPV6:
sudo vi /etc/modprobe.d/blacklist.conf
2.在文檔最後添加 blacklist ipv6,然後查看修改結果:
cat /etc/modprobe.d/blacklist.conf
3.設置IP(設置網卡eth0的IP地址和子網掩碼)
sudo ifconfig eth0 192.168.2.1 netmask 255.255.255.0
4.設置網關
sudo route add default gw 192.168.2.254
5.設置DNS 修改/etc/resolv.conf,在其中加入nameserver DNS的地址1 和 nameserver DNS的地址2 完成。
6.重啟網路服務(若不行,請重啟ubuntu:sudo reboot):
sudo /etc/init.d/networking restart
7.查看當前IP:
ifconfig
二、直接修改系統配置文件
ubuntu的網路配置文件是:/etc/network/interfaces
打開後裡面可設置DHCP或手動設置靜態ip。前面auto eth0,讓網卡開機自動掛載。
1. 以DHCP方式配置網卡
編輯文件/etc/network/interfaces:
sudo vi /etc/network/interfaces
並用下面的行來替換有關eth0的行:
# The primary network interface - use DHCP to find our address
auto eth0
iface eth0 inet dhcp
用下面的命令使網路設置生效:
sudo /etc/init.d/networking restart
也可以在命令行下直接輸入下面的命令來獲取地址
sudo dhclient eth0
2. 為網卡配置靜態IP地址
編輯文件/etc/network/interfaces:
sudo vi /etc/network/interfaces
並用下面的行來替換有關eth0的行:
# The primary network interface
auto eth0
iface eth0 inet static
address 192.168.2.1
gateway 192.168.2.254
netmask 255.255.255.0
#network 192.168.2.0
#broadcast 192.168.2.255
將上面的ip地址等信息換成你自己就可以了.用下面的命令使網路設置生效:
sudo /etc/init.d/networking restart
3. 設定第二個IP地址(虛擬IP地址)
編輯文件/etc/network/interfaces:
sudo vi /etc/network/interfaces
在該文件中添加如下的行:
auto eth0:1
iface eth0:1 inet static
address x.x.x.x
netmask x.x.x.x
network x.x.x.x
broadcast x.x.x.x
gateway x.x.x.x
根據你的情況填上所有諸如address,netmask,network,broadcast和gateways等信息:
用下面的命令使網路設置生效:
sudo /etc/init.d/networking restart
4. 設置主機名稱(hostname)
使用下面的命令來查看當前主機的主機名稱:
sudo /bin/hostname
使用下面的命令來設置當前主機的主機名稱:
sudo /bin/hostname newname
系統啟動時,它會從/etc/hostname來讀取主機的名稱。
5. 配置DNS
首先,你可以在/etc/hosts中加入一些主機名稱和這些主機名稱對應的IP地址,這是簡單使用本機的靜態查詢。要訪問DNS 伺服器來進行查詢,需要設置/etc/resolv.conf文件,假設DNS伺服器的IP地址是192.168.2.2, 那麼/etc/resolv.conf文件的內容應為:
search chotim.com
nameserver 192.168.2.2
6.手動重啟網路服務:
sudo /etc/init.d/networking restart
返回結果如下:
*Reconfiguring network interfaces… [OK]